Planting Calendar for Canna

Frost tolerance for canna: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ost has passed.

You really shouldn't plant canna until after the last frost when the weather gets warmer because they require warm weather.

The earliest that you can plant canna in Kennesaw is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ant canna and expect a good harvest is probably August. You probably don't want to wait any later than that or else your canna may not have a chance to grow to maturity. You can get started a couple of weeks earlier by starting your canna indoors.

Last Frost Date

The average date of last frost is April 15 in Kennesaw. In the coldest months of winter you can expect an average low temperature of 5°F.

Keep in mind that USDA zone info for Kennesaw may not be accurate from year to year and the actual date of last frost is different every year. Since half of the time in Kennesaw you get a frost after April 15 be ready to protect your canna in the event of a surprise late frost.
